ABSTRACT

This chapter introduces the merits and value of using technology in the early childhood setting. Covered are guidelines for using interactive media and technology for young children. A framework is included to ensure the integration and use of interactive media and technology for young children are performed with integrity, thought for developmentally appropriate practice, learning behaviors, and best practices when integrating technology into the classroom experience. Examples of technology and interactive media appropriate for young children are listed as resources for teachers. How technology can be used to enhance adult and child relationships is discussed. At the end of this chapter are two grids, one outlines the arts with suggestions for ways to integrate them into STEM and the other is the skill grid for developmentally appropriate practices among other skill sets.
